Code modification method:
Log on to SQLPLUS with system and password, and then:
1. log on to oracle with sys
Connect sys/password as sysdba; (Can I directly log on to sqlplus using sys ?)
2. start modifying the encoding.
Shutdown immediate; stop oracle services and listen. This parameter can be omitted if the service is stopped.
Startup mount;
Alter system enable restricted session;
Alter system set job_queue_processes = 0; initialize the job
Alter database open;
Alter database character set internal_use utf8; set the Encoding
Shutdown immediate;
Startup;
Now the encoding is complete.
